Biomass burning events, including wildfires, emit large amounts of phenolic compounds such as catechol. These compounds can react with nitrate radicals (NO), a key nighttime oxidant, to form secondary organic aerosol (SOA). Although SOA is traditionally assumed to be noncrystalline, we present surprising evidence from X-ray diffraction that SOA formed from catechol + NO in an atmospheric simulation chamber contains crystalline material.

Cancer-derived small extracellular vesicles have been proposed as promising potential biomarkers for diagnosis and prognosis of breast cancer (BC). We performed a proteomic study of lysine acetylation of breast cancer-derived small extracellular vesicles (sEVs) to understand the potential role of the aberrant acetylated proteins in the biology of invasive ductal carcinoma and triple-negative BC. Three cell lines were used as models for this study: MCF10A (non-metastatic), MCF7 (estrogen and progesterone receptor-positive, metastatic) and MDA-MB-231 (triple-negative, highly metastatic).
